Definitions and Meaning of forbear in English

Wordnet

forbear (n)

a person from whom you are descended

Wordnet

forbear (v)

refrain from doing

resist doing something

Webster

forbear (n.)

An ancestor; a forefather; -- usually in the plural.

Webster

forbear (v. i.)

To refrain from proceeding; to pause; to delay.

To refuse; to decline; to give no heed.

To control one's self when provoked.

Webster

forbear (v. t.)

To keep away from; to avoid; to abstain from; to give up; as, to forbear the use of a word of doubdtful propriety.

To treat with consideration or indulgence.

To cease from bearing.
